A rare opportunity to own a true legacy property in the gated mountain community of Big Canoe. Perched at approximately 2,800 feet in elevation amid the natural beauty of North Georgia, this remarkable one-owner residence was thoughtfully designed for gathering generations of family and friends under one roof. With just under 10,000 square feet between the main residence and attached guest house, the property offers an extraordinary combination of space, privacy, architectural character and mountain living. Designed by architect Bob Ahlstrand and built by Gary Harbin in 1987, the home was further enhanced in 1995 with kitchen and owners' bath renovations and a thoughtfully integrated addition. Altogether, the main residence and guest house offer nine bedrooms, eight baths, four living and family rooms and two kitchens—providing exceptional flexibility for extended family, guests and entertaining. Warm woods, natural stone, expansive windows and dramatic architectural details give the home a character all its own. The addition features beautiful green slate flooring that flows seamlessly outdoors into a private courtyard—one of the property's most memorable spaces. Here, a massive stone fireplace creates a dramatic gathering place alongside a peaceful reflecting pool featuring a commissioned bronze sculpture of geese, cattails and lily pads. Throughout the home, unexpected spaces add to its sense of discovery. A hot tub enjoys its own dedicated screened porch, while a hidden wine room tucked away on the terrace level is waiting to be found. Accessible from the main residence by a breezeway, the self-sufficient two-bedroom, two-bath guest house provides wonderful privacy while keeping guests close. Its main level features a den with fireplace, full kitchen, bedroom with en suite bath and a deck overlooking the mountain views. The terrace level offers a second bedroom and bath, den, laundry and generous storage. Owned and cherished by the same family since it was built

Priced Below Appraised Value! One-level living in Big Canoe—done right. This 2021 custom ranch in the Audubon neighborhood combines accessibility, quality construction and a convenient location near the North Gate while remaining close to amenities. Designed for lasting comfort, the home offers zero-step entry, wide doorways, and a wheelchair-accessible kitchen and primary bath. The impressive great room features a floor-to-ceiling fireplace, vaulted ceilings with exposed beams, and oversized windows that fill the space with natural light. The beautifully appointed kitchen includes custom cabinetry, Caf appliances, quartz countertops and a walk-in pantry, flowing easily into the dining and living areas. Covered front and rear porches with tongue-and-groove ceilings and sandstone flooring invite outdoor enjoyment. The spacious primary suite includes an accessible bath and connects to a flexible room ideal for an office, sitting room, studio or additional bedroom. Every bedroom is ensuite with a walk-in closet and built-in dresser, including an upstairs guest suite. The expanded garage features oversized doors, epoxy flooring and room for a gym, workshop or storage. Additional upgrades include a whole-house generator with propane tank, tankless water heater, integrated IT cabinet, exterior cameras, custom millwork, wood and tile flooring, upgraded lighting, professional landscaping and an added parking pad.
